This is an automated email from the ASF dual-hosted git repository.

snoopdave p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/roller.git


    from 5b6cbbf3a Merge pull request #119 from mbien/dependency_updates_2
     add 85be53630 Refactoring index implementation to isolate Lucene 
dependency.
     add 1157bc3bf Progress towards test for SearchResultsModel
     add 880a94d8f Progress on refactoring
     add d725bc4ea Lucene API usage now isolated in search.lucene package.
     add 6de2fcf84 test fix
     add 51e40eeb1 Whittle down the code a bit more.
     add c8865d359 Whittle down the code a bit more.
     add fab95f5a2 Merge pull request #123 from snoopdave/solr-impl

No new revisions were added by this update.

Summary of changes:
 app/pom.xml                                        |  31 +++
 .../weblogger/business/jpa/JPAWebloggerModule.java |   4 +-
 .../weblogger/business/search/IndexManager.java    |  71 +++----
 .../search/SearchResultList.java}                  |  47 ++---
 .../{TestTask.java => search/SearchResultMap.java} |  61 +++---
 .../{operations => lucene}/AddEntryOperation.java  |  11 +-
 .../search/{ => lucene}/FieldConstants.java        |   2 +-
 .../{operations => lucene}/IndexOperation.java     |  18 +-
 .../business/search/{ => lucene}/IndexUtil.java    |   4 +-
 .../LuceneIndexManager.java}                       | 207 ++++++++++++++++-----
 .../ReIndexEntryOperation.java                     |  12 +-
 .../ReadFromIndexOperation.java                    |   9 +-
 .../RebuildWebsiteIndexOperation.java              |  25 ++-
 .../RemoveEntryOperation.java                      |  12 +-
 .../RemoveWebsiteIndexOperation.java               |  15 +-
 .../{operations => lucene}/SearchOperation.java    |  46 +++--
 .../WriteToIndexOperation.java                     |  13 +-
 .../business/search/lucene}/package-info.java      |   4 +-
 .../business/search/operations/package-info.java   |  22 ---
 .../weblogger/business/search/package-info.java    |   2 +-
 .../business/search/solr/SolrIndexManager.java     |  88 +++++++++
 .../apache/roller/weblogger/pojos/WeblogEntry.java |   2 +-
 .../ui/rendering/model/SearchResultsFeedModel.java | 149 ++++-----------
 .../ui/rendering/model/SearchResultsModel.java     | 183 +++++-------------
 .../ui/rendering/util/WeblogSearchRequest.java     |   2 +-
 .../weblogger/ui/struts2/editor/Maintenance.java   |   3 +-
 app/src/main/resources/log4j2.xml                  |   1 +
 app/src/main/resources/rome.properties             |   2 +-
 .../java/org/apache/roller/util/DerbyManager.java  |   2 +-
 .../weblogger/business/IndexManagerTest.java       | 157 ----------------
 .../business/search/IndexManagerTest.java          | 158 ++++++++++++++++
 .../model/SearchResultsFeedModelTest.java          | 128 +++++++++++++
 .../ui/rendering/model/SearchResultsModelTest.java | 142 ++++++++++++++
 app/src/test/resources/log4j2.xml                  |   2 +-
 34 files changed, 963 insertions(+), 672 deletions(-)
 copy 
app/src/main/java/org/apache/roller/weblogger/{ui/core/util/menu/Menu.java => 
business/search/SearchResultList.java} (52%)
 copy app/src/main/java/org/apache/roller/weblogger/business/{TestTask.java => 
search/SearchResultMap.java} (51%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/AddEntryOperation.java (88%)
 rename app/src/main/java/org/apache/roller/weblogger/business/search/{ => 
lucene}/FieldConstants.java (96%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/IndexOperation.java (93%)
 rename app/src/main/java/org/apache/roller/weblogger/business/search/{ => 
lucene}/IndexUtil.java (94%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{IndexManagerImpl.java
 => lucene/LuceneIndexManager.java} (60%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/ReIndexEntryOperation.java (86%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/ReadFromIndexOperation.java (80%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/RebuildWebsiteIndexOperation.java (85%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/RemoveEntryOperation.java (85%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/RemoveWebsiteIndexOperation.java (85%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/SearchOperation.java (81%)
 rename 
app/src/main/java/org/apache/roller/weblogger/business/search/{operations => 
lucene}/WriteToIndexOperation.java (78%)
 copy app/src/main/java/org/apache/roller/{planet/business => 
weblogger/business/search/lucene}/package-info.java (89%)
 delete mode 100644 
app/src/main/java/org/apache/roller/weblogger/business/search/operations/package-info.java
 create mode 100644 
app/src/main/java/org/apache/roller/weblogger/business/search/solr/SolrIndexManager.java
 delete mode 100644 
app/src/test/java/org/apache/roller/weblogger/business/IndexManagerTest.java
 create mode 100644 
app/src/test/java/org/apache/roller/weblogger/business/search/IndexManagerTest.java
 create mode 100644 
app/src/test/java/org/apache/roller/weblogger/ui/rendering/model/SearchResultsFeedModelTest.java
 create mode 100644 
app/src/test/java/org/apache/roller/weblogger/ui/rendering/model/SearchResultsModelTest.java

Reply via email to